A sermon preach'd at the funeral of Sir Alan Broderick, Kt. who dyed at Wandsworth in the county of Surrey, on Thursday, November 25th, and was interr'd there on Friday, Decemb. 3d., 1680 / by Nathanael Resbury ... .

Resbury, Nathanael, 1643-1711
Publisher: Printed for Walter Kettilby
Place of Publication: London
Publication Year: 1681
Approximate Era: CharlesII
TCP ID: A57059 ESTC ID: R36714 STC ID: R1129
Subject Headings: Bible. -- O.T. -- Isaiah LVII, 1; Broderick, Alan, -- Sir, d. 1680; Funeral sermons; Sermons, English -- 17th century;
